Detailed Itinerary |
Day 1: Istanbul, Bosphorus Cruise.
Friday April 23.
At the terminal keep your eyes open for the Travel Talk representative, as we pick you up from the airport and take you to our Istanbul hotel. Gather round in the hotel lobby at 6:00pm as we meet both the other tour members and the guide. Listen up for a fast and informal meeting with the leader including registration and a short brief about the adventures ahead and some country info. After the welcome has concluded we will then take a relaxing cruise along to magnificent Bosphorus capturing the delights of Istanbul.
Day 2: Istanbul, Gallipoli
Saturday April 24.
After breakfast we jump into the coach and head for the shores of Gallipoli. Tonight we set up camp to ensure the best position is kept for the Dawn Service and sleep under the stars in the ceremony area.
Day 3: Dawn Service, Gallipoli Ceremonies, Ayvalik.
Sunday April 25.
We wake before the break of dawn and watch as the sun rises over the battle field, we remember the soldiers who lost their lives on this exact day all those years ago. We also attend the National ceremonies and services later in the day. Tonight we re-charge and freshen up with dinner and an overnight stay in Ayvalik.We
will have Anzac BBQ tonight.
Day 4: Ayvalik, Troy, Gallipoli
Monday April 26.
After breakfast we spend some time exploring this charming, ancient town of Ayvalik, with its many Ottoman Greek houses, and orthodox churches now converted to mosques.
Then we head to the ancient city of Troy, the setting of Homer's epic, Iliad, involving a giant wooden horse.
Day 5: Gallipoli, Istanbul
Tuesday April 27.
Our exploration of the Gallipoli peninsular continues without the crowds in silence and quiet contemplation to truly capture the ANZAC spirit. Today provides a more detailed and personal experience to reflect and explore the history and heartbeat of this region, we see and experience each of the areas of historical significance including Kabatepe War Museum, Lone Pine, Chunuk Bair, Jonston’s Jolly, North Beach, Ari Burnu, Hell Spit, Brighton Beach, Shrapnel Valley, Artillery Road, Quinn’s Post, Turkish Memorial, the Nek and Walker’s Ridge. In the afternoon we return to Istanbul. This is a day to enjoy the amazing Turkish scenery unfold before us, while listening to your music player or just watching the small towns and villages pass. As we get into Istanbul in the evening, keep a look out for the stunning light show that is on every night! The oldest and best buildings are lit up over the Bosphorus, and the two bridges joining Asia to Europe are spectacular. We sleep over night in Istanbul.
Day 6: Istanbul
Wednesday April 28.
After breakfast we begin to experience the magnificence of Istanbul. We stroll through the old town visiting Blue Mosque, Hippodrome, majestic Topkapi Palace and the Underground Cistern. Our trip will finish around 1.30pm please book your flights accordingly. We wish you safe travels!
